WebMar 23, 2024 · Responsibilities The Mandated Materials Manager has oversight for end-to-end development of all KelseyCare Advantage marketing and member materials (e.g., Annual Notice of Change, Summary of Benefits, Evidence of Coverage for all plan benefit packages, pharmacy directory, provider directory) in compliance with CMS regulations … WebAug 11, 2024 · Short Answer: Employers must provide the Medicare Part D Creditable Coverage, CHIP, and WHCRA notices annually. Typically, employers will time the distribution of all the required notices to meet the October 15 Medicare Part D Creditable Coverage notice deadline. WebFeb 11, 2024 · Section 111 RREs are required to register for Section 111 reporting and fully test the data exchange before submitting production files. The registration process provides notification to CMS of the RRE’s intent to report data to comply with the requirements of Section 111.
